Fluke to acquire thermographic equipment provider

By Control Engineering Staff October 20, 2005

Fluke Electronics Corp. announced it intends to acquire Infrared Solutions, a provider of portable thermography products. Fluke expects the transaction to close during 4Q2005, following the satisfaction of certain closing conditions.

Infrared Solutions applies infrared (IR) technology for commercial and industrial use. It is a privately owned firm headquartered in Plymouth, MN, that designs, manufactures, and sells a broad array of thermal imaging products for use across a number of channels, including predictive and preventative maintenance. Products include the IR FlexCam and IR InSight, rugged, easy-to-use, portable thermographic cameras with advanced reporting software.

Fluke makes compact, professional electronic test tools for technicians, engineers, electricians and others who install, troubleshoot, and manage industrial electrical and electronic equipment and calibration processes for quality control. The company introduced its first thermography product, Fluke Ti30, earlier this year.
